Product Description
Ionophore antibiotic. Inhibitor of the S. cerevisiae ABC transporter Pdr5p.
Inhibitor of acyl-CoA-cholesterol acyltransferase and of phosphodiesterase. Potential anticancer compound.

Product Description
Antibiotic that functions as Na+ ionophore. Blocks glycoprotein secretion. Inhibits proliferation of several lymphoma cell lines through cell cycle arrest and apoptosis.

Product Description

Acts as an H+, K+, Pb2+ ionophore. Is most commonly an antiporter of H+ and K+. Inhibits the Golgi functions.

Product Description
Ionophoric. Chelates monovalent cations, preferably sodium ions and transports them passively through biological membranes. Displays antimicrobial and cytotoxic properties and selective and potent antimalarial activity.

Product Description
Cation ionophore with high selectivity for ammonium and potassium. Inhibits T cell proliferation induced by IL-2 and cytokine production at nanomolar levels for IL-2, IL-4, IL-5 and interferon-γ.

Product Description
Antibiotic possessing weak in vitro antimicrobial activity against gram positive bacteria and fungi. Divalent cation ionophore commonly used to increase intracellular Ca2+ levels in intact cells.
